Una tasa de flujo de agua de fondo que ingresa al dispositivo de succion es la misma o mayor que una tasa de flujo de agua succionada por un sistema de bombeo externo.A suction device that operates to suck floccules produced by flocculants or coagulants from the bottom of large artificial bodies of water without centralized filtration systems. The suction device includes a flexible plate as a structural frame, various brushes, suction points, safety wheels, collection means, internal suction lines, and coupling means. A flow rate of bottom water entering the suction device is the same or greater than a flow rate of water sucked in by an external pump system.
